What are the key excipient considerations for Flumisch Batana Oil?
The formulation of Flumisch Batana Oil for hair growth hinges on selecting excipients that support stability, enhance bioavailability, and improve user experience. Key excipient types include carriers, stabilizers, and preservatives.
Carrier and base materials
- Oils and oils blends: The primary ingredient, Batana oil, acts as both active and carrier. Additional carrier oils (e.g., jojoba oil, coconut oil) may dilute or enhance efficacy.
- Emulsifiers: If formulated as a topical cream or serum, emulsifiers like cetyl alcohol or stearic acid can stabilize oil-in-water or water-in-oil emulsions.
Stabilizers and preservatives
- Antioxidants: Tocopherols or ascorbyl palmitate prevent lipid oxidation, extending shelf life.
- Preservatives: Phenoxyethanol or parabens inhibit microbial growth in water-based formulations.
- pH buffers: Citric acid or sodium citrate maintain stability and compatibility with scalp skin.
Delivery system considerations
- Nanoemulsions or liposomes: May improve penetration into hair follicles.
- Carry formulations: Serums, oils, or sprays, each requiring different excipient compatibilities.
How does excipient choice impact the product’s stability and efficacy?
The selection of stable, compatible excipients can prevent degradation of Batana oil and ensure consistent delivery of active components. Formulation pH influences both stability and skin compatibility; typically, a pH between 4.5 and 5.5 suits scalp application.
Nanotechnology-based excipients enhance follicular penetration, potentially increasing efficacy. However, they demand precise formulation to avoid aggregation or instability. Incorporation of antioxidants reduces rancidity, especially critical for oil-rich formulations.

3. Are preservatives necessary for Batana oil-based products?
If water is present in the formulation, preservatives are necessary to prevent microbial growth. Oil-only products typically do not require preservatives.
